Sky Collins is the heart behind Oklahoma Rare, a statewide community and coalition supporting Oklahoma families affected by rare diseases. She is the mother of a daughter with Malan Syndrome, diagnosed after an 8½-year diagnostic journey, and a passionate rare disease advocate. Her experience navigating that journey inspired her to found Oklahoma Rare.

In her role, Sky helps connect patients, caregivers, and policymakers across the state to drive education, advocacy, and equity in rare disease care. In 2025, Sky spearheaded Oklahoma Rare Voices, a publication sharing the stories of 16 Oklahomans and their families living with rare diseases. For her, putting faces to diagnoses isn’t just symbolic— it’s transformative.

She also serves on the Malan Syndrome Parent Advisory Board, contributes to national research and care efforts, and is a dedicated member of the Rare Disease Diversity Coalition (RDDC), committed to advancing health equity within rare disease communities. With her lived experience, Sky brings to the RDLA Advisory Committee a voice steeped in community, equity, and the deep conviction that our stories are the spark for systemic change.
